News: Dearne Valley Eco-vision published

By

Consultants at urban regeneration experts, Urbed have published the Dearne Valley Eco-vision.


Developed by the Dearne Valley Special Board, the vision would see the Dearne Valley reimagined as an eco-valley.

Features include new transport links, developing environmental technologies, efficient and sustainable land use and strong communities, with purpose, identity and cohesion.

In the Foreword local MP, John Healey states that: "This is a project which could once again place the Dearne on the national map. The eco vision will see a move to a high quality, low carbon environment bringing new jobs and leading technologies and techniques to tackle climate change. There will be opportunities for everyone in the Dearne to become involved."

The vision incorporates a new "lean green economic model" based on growing and managing natural assets through forestry, conservation and tourism and developing a new low carbon infrastructure through new energy and eco-building services.
